Desencadenar acciones en MySQL Workbench con Trigger

MySQL Workbench es una herramienta de gestión de bases de datos que permite realizar diversas tareas de manera sencilla y rápida. Una de las funcionalidades más útiles que ofrece es la posibilidad de utilizar triggers para desencadenar acciones en la base de datos. Un trigger es un procedimiento almacenado que se ejecuta automáticamente en respuesta a ciertos eventos, como la inserción, actualización o eliminación de datos en una tabla específica. En este artículo, exploraremos cómo utilizar los triggers en MySQL Workbench para automatizar tareas y mejorar la eficiencia en la gestión de bases de datos.

Aprendiendo el proceso detrás de los triggers: Cómo se ejecutan en las bases de datos

¿Qué son los triggers?

Los triggers son acciones que se realizan de forma automática por la base de datos, en respuesta a ciertos eventos. Esencialmente, son desencadenadores que se activan cuando se lleva a cabo una acción específica en una tabla.

¿Cómo funcionan los triggers en las bases de datos?

Los triggers funcionan en tres sencillos pasos: el primer paso es el evento que dispara el trigger, el segundo es la acción que se toma en respuesta al evento y el tercero es el resultado que produce la acción.

Para entender mejor, imagine que se realiza una actualización en una tabla de base de datos. Si hay un trigger configurado en esa tabla, se activará automáticamente después de que se haya completado la actualización.

El desencadenador se ejecuta y realiza la acción especificada en la configuración del trigger. Esto podría incluir cualquier número de cosas, como enviar un correo electrónico de notificación, actualizar otro registro de base de datos, o incluso ejecutar un script más complejo.

Concatenar en MySQL: Guía práctica paso a pasoCómo unir dos campos en MySQL: guía rápida

Cómo configurar un trigger

Los triggers se pueden configurar en la mayoría de los sistemas de gestión de base de datos (DBMS) como Oracle, SQL Server, MySQL, etc. La mayoría de las veces, se configuran utilizando una sintaxis SQL especial que especifica el evento que debe desencadenar la acción, así como la acción que se debe tomar cuando se activa el trigger.

Final Thoughts

Ahora que tiene una mejor comprensión de cómo funcionan los triggers en las bases de datos, es posible que desee comenzar a explorar cómo puede utilizarlos para automatizar sus propias tareas. Hay muchas opciones disponibles, y la configuración de los triggers adecuados podría ahorrarle tiempo y esfuerzo a largo plazo.

Sin embargo, es importante recordar que los triggers pueden ser una herramienta poderosa, y es importante comprender completamente cómo funcionan antes de comenzar a usarlos en una aplicación de producción. Con un poco de práctica y dedicación, puede convertirse en un experto en triggers y sacar más provecho de sus bases de datos.

Aprende a utilizar los triggers en MySQL: explicación de su sintaxis

Los triggers son una característica importante en MySQL ya que permiten automatizar acciones en una base de datos cuando se cumple una determinada condición.

Para crear un trigger, se utiliza la sintaxis CREATE TRIGGER, seguida del nombre del trigger, la acción que lo desencadene (BEFORE o AFTER), y la sentencia que se ejecutará cuando se cumpla la condición.

Agregar datos a tabla MySQL: Guía prácticaConoce cómo gestionar usuarios MySQL desde la consola

Es importante mencionar que los triggers pueden activarse para diferentes eventos, como por ejemplo INSERT, UPDATE o DELETE. Además, existen variables especiales a utilizar dentro del trigger, como OLD y NEW, que permiten acceder a los valores antiguo y nuevo de los registros involucrados.

Para eliminar un trigger, se utiliza la sintaxis DROP TRIGGER, seguida del nombre del trigger.

En resumen, los triggers son una herramienta útil para automatizar acciones en una base de datos en función de ciertas condiciones, y su sintaxis básica consiste en la creación del trigger, la definición del evento que lo activará y la sentencia a ejecutar.

¿Has utilizado alguna vez triggers en MySQL? ¿Qué aplicaciones has encontrado para esta herramienta?

Todo lo que necesitas saber sobre los triggers en MySQL: la clave para la automatización efectiva de tus bases de datos.

Los triggers son una herramienta extremadamente útil en la gestión y automatización de bases de datos en MySQL. De manera sencilla, un trigger es una función que se ejecuta automáticamente cuando un evento específico ocurre en una tabla de la base de datos.

Guía práctica para integrar VBS con MySQLGuía práctica para integrar VBS con MySQL

Los eventos que pueden activar un trigger pueden variar, desde la inserción de una nueva fila en una tabla, hasta la actualización o eliminación de datos. Es importante tener en cuenta que los triggers se ejecutan después de que el evento que los activa haya tenido lugar.

Los triggers son especialmente útiles cuando se necesita una mayor automatización en el manejo de datos. Por ejemplo, cuando se requiere mantener la integridad referencial de la base de datos y se necesita actualizar automáticamente tablas secundarias cuando se actualiza una fila en la tabla principal.

Es importante resaltar que los triggers deben ser diseñados de manera cuidadosa. Una mala implementación puede afectar en gran medida el rendimiento de la base de datos, especialmente en entornos de altas cargas de trabajo.

Para utilizar correctamente los triggers es esencial conocer bien su sintaxis y funcionalidades. MySQL ofrece una amplia documentación sobre el tema, así como ejemplos de casos de uso comunes.

En conclusión, los triggers son una herramienta poderosa para la gestión de bases de datos en MySQL. Con su ayuda, es posible automatizar y mejorar significativamente la gestión de los datos. Sin embargo, es importante utilizarlos sabiamente y con cuidado para evitar problemas de rendimiento.

¿Qué opinas sobre la implementación de triggers en MySQL? ¿Has tenido alguna experiencia utilizando esta herramienta? ¡Déjanos tus comentarios y comparte tus opiniones con la comunidad!

En conclusión, los Triggers en MySQL Workbench son herramientas poderosas que te permiten automatizar procesos y hacer que tu trabajo diario sea más eficiente. Con su facilidad de uso y capacidad de personalización, los Triggers se están convirtiendo rápidamente en una necesidad para cualquier persona que trabaje con MySQL Workbench.

Esperamos que este artículo haya sido un recurso útil para aprender acerca de la creación y utilización de Triggers en MySQL Workbench. ¡Gracias por leer!

¡Hasta la próxima!

Si quieres conocer otros artículos parecidos a Desencadenar acciones en MySQL Workbench con Trigger puedes visitar la categoría Informática.

Ivan

Soy un entusiasta de la tecnología con especialización en bases de datos, particularmente en MySQL. A través de mis tutoriales detallados, busco desmitificar los conceptos complejos y proporcionar soluciones prácticas a los desafíos cotidianos relacionados con la gestión de datos

Aprende mas sobre MySQL

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Subir